MELBOURNE INTERNATIONAL EXHIBITION, 1880, in bronze (76mm) by H.Stokes, edge impressed 'J.McFarlane - Juror'. Spot on reverse, mark on face otherwise FDC.
J.McFarlane was Juror for Section 8 - Mathematical Instruments, Cutlery, Clocks and Watches.
